LANCASTER, SC –Mr. Eric Stephen "Steve" Pettit, age 65, of Lancaster, passed away Wednesday, February 14, 2024, at his home surrounded by his family. He was born December 18, 1958, in Lancaster, a son of the late Joseph Franklin Pettit, Jr. and Eleanor Pettit-Brouwer and was the husband of Tammy Cauthen Pettit. Steve was a very talented building contractor, who was an exceptional craftsman when it came to installing moldings and had the ability to construct a masterpiece from a small sketch. He enjoyed being outdoors, working on his farm, watching wildlife, fishing, and riding horses. Family was most important to him, and he was a very devoted loving husband and father. His wife Tammy and his daughter Paige were his whole world. Steve was a very outgoing, friendly person who enjoyed spending time with his family and daily phone conversation with his many friends.
Steve is survived by his wife of 24 years, Tammy Pettit; his daughter, Paige Pettit and her boyfriend, Chance Jordan of Lancaster; two brothers, Adrian Pettit and his wife Denise and Bryan Pettit and his wife Lisa all of Lancaster; a sister, Pam Vaughn and her husband Randy of Lancaster; his stepfather, Don Brouwer; and numerous nieces and nephews.
